General description
Chromolith® columns are made of monolithic silica with a characteristic bimodal pore structure.
Chromolith® HighResolution RP-18 endcapped columns have macropores with 1.15 μm diameter, giving a column efficiency exceeding 140,000 plates/meter. The mesopores are 15 nm (150 Å), and the surface modification is octadecylsilane with full end-capping. Chromolith® HighResolution RP-18 endcapped columns fall under the USP L1 Classification. The column efficiency is comparable to a 2.7 to 3 μm particle size fully porous particulate column.
The column dimension of 50 mm length and 2 mm I.D. is the best choice for fast and high-resolution separations meeting UHPLC and LC-MS needs.
Chromolith® HighResolution RP-18 endcapped columns with 2 mm internal diameter are ideal for use with UHPLC or UPLC instruments, thanks to their very small internal volumes. A particular benefit is very fast analysis, reduced sample preparation and the low column backpressure. Ultra-high performance and extremely low operating pressure make Chromolith® 2 mm I.D. columns truly unique. Chromolith® and Chromolith® HighResolution columns are perfectly suitable for LC-MS use; however, the column dimension of 2 mm I.D. or below is preferred to be used in LC-MS methods.
The revolutionary, monolithic silica with its unique combination of macropores and mesopores enables:
—Rapid separations at very low column back-pressure
—High matrix tolerance, allowing time and cost savings with simplified workflows
—Cost-savings due to extended column lifetimes
—Connection of columns, flow gradients and the use of mobile phases with higher viscosity
